On Sat, May 23, 2026 at 7:09 PM Devine, Harry (FAA) <[email protected]<mailto:[email protected]>> wrote: When I run the TigerVNC client viewer from one of our VMs to my VNC server, I get prompted for the password. My connection DOES have the password in it (see attached screenshot, with the password hidden and the hostname blanked out for redaction), so that’s probably why. But that password in the Guac connection is the exact same password that is configured for the user at port 5902, and the one that I enter when the viewer prompts me. It seems that, for some reason, Guacamole just isn’t sending the password. And based on the tcpdump that my network admin looked over, with the Guac connection attempt, the VNC server sends back a hex value to, I believe, encrypt the connection password and send back to the server, but Guac seems to just send back that same hex value. Yeah, this is really puzzling - I've tried my best to replicate the environment that you have, and, if I put the password in the connection settings, it works fine and connects immediately, and if I leave the password blank, it prompts for it and works fine.
